Javan was a son of Japheth whose name became associated with the Greek or Ionian peoples.
Biography
Genesis 10 and 1 Chronicles 1 list Javan among Japheth's sons and name Elishah, Tarshish, Kittim, and Dodanim or Rodanim among his descendants. Later prophetic texts use Javan as a designation associated with Greek peoples or lands.
Biblical Significance
Javan links the Table of Nations with the biblical world's later awareness of Greek peoples. The personal ancestor and later ethnic designation should be distinguished while crosslinked.
